About Sanaa Ashour
Sanaa Ashour is a scholar working on Business and International Management, Education and Political Science and International Relations, having authored 20 papers that have together received 262 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Higher Education Governance and Development (8 papers), Online and Blended Learning (3 papers) and Evaluation of Teaching Practices (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Computer Science Applications (39 citations), Business and International Management (12 citations) and Management of Technology and Innovation (31 citations). Sanaa Ashour has collaborated with scholars based in United Arab Emirates, Qatar and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Ghaleb A. El Refae, Nicole F. Bromfield, Maxwell Peprah Opoku, Abdoulaye Kaba and William Nketsia. Their work appears in journals such as Studies in Higher Education, Higher Education Research & Development and Disability & Society.
